Can you post Instagram Stories from desktop?
Yes. Instagram has started rolling out the ability to upload and post Instagram Stories from desktop through Instagram.com.
This means you can take a photo or video saved on your computer and upload it directly to your Instagram Story without first having to send the file to your phone.
For businesses and social media managers who create content in programs like Canva or store client content on their computer, this could make the process of posting Instagram Stories much simpler.
You can also create content within the desktop Story feature before publishing.
How to post an Instagram Story from desktop
If the new Instagram desktop Story feature has been rolled out to your account, posting a Story from your computer is simple.
-
Head to Instagram.com on your desktop.
-
Go to your Instagram profile.
-
Click the blue plus symbol.
-
Select the option to create a Story.
-
Upload a photo or video from your computer or create your Story there.
-
Edit your Instagram Story.
-
Publish your Story.
Your Story will then appear on Instagram just as it would if you had posted it through the Instagram mobile app.
What if I can't post Instagram Stories from desktop yet?
If you log into Instagram on your computer and can't see the option to create a Story, it doesn't necessarily mean anything is wrong with your account.
Like many new Instagram features and Instagram updates, desktop Stories appear to be rolling out gradually.
Instagram regularly releases new features to groups of users rather than making them available to every Instagram account at exactly the same time.
This also means that if you're a social media manager managing multiple Instagram accounts, you may find the desktop Story feature is available on some accounts before others.
Keep checking Instagram.com as the feature continues to roll out.
Can you schedule Instagram Stories from desktop?
If you want to schedule Instagram Stories from your computer, you can do this using Meta Business Suite.
Rather than publishing your Story immediately, Meta Business Suite allows eligible business and creator accounts to prepare Instagram Stories in advance and choose a date and time for them to be published.
This is particularly useful if you're batching your Instagram content or managing social media content for multiple businesses.
So if you want to post a Story immediately, you may be able to do it directly through Instagram on desktop.
If you want to schedule an Instagram Story for later, Meta Business Suite remains a useful option.

Instagram is making desktop more useful for content creation
Instagram has traditionally been a mobile-first social media platform, but over time more Instagram features have become available through desktop.
You can already use Instagram on desktop to manage DMs, publish feed posts and carousels, upload Reels and manage different parts of your Instagram account.
Adding Instagram Stories to desktop makes the web version of Instagram even more useful, particularly for businesses and people managing Instagram professionally.
